Description
Human Interleukin-13 Receptor Alpha 2 ELISA Kit. IL-13 receptor alpha 2, also known as CD213α2, is a subunit of IL-13 receptor complex. It is encoded by the gene locus Xq13.1-q28 on chromosome X. An important characteristic of this subunit is that it does not have a cytoplasmic domain. Even though, the IL-13 Rα2 binds to IL 13 with high affinity, the receptor appears not directly involved with a typical IL-13 stimulated signal transduction. PRINCIPLE ASSAY
This assay applies the quantitative sandwich enzyme immunoassay technique. A monoclonal antibody specific to IL-13 Rα2 has been pre-coated onto a microplate. Standards and samples are then added to the appropriate plate wells with a biotin - conjugated antibody preparation specific for IL-13 Rα2 and incubated. IL-13 Rα2 if present, will bind and become immobilized by the antibody pre-coated on the wells and then be "sandwiched" by biotin conjugate. Avidin is a tetramer containing four identical subunits that each has a high affinity-binding site for biotin. After washing away any unbound substances, avidin-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) will be added to each well and incubated. Following a wash to remove any unbound antibody-enzyme reagent, a substrate solution is added to the wells and only those wells that contain IL-13 Rα2, biotin conjugated antibody and enzyme-conjugated Avidin will exhibit a change in colour. The colour development is stopped and the intensity of the colour is measured. <br></br>In order to measure the concentration of IL-13 Rα2 in the samples, this package of reagent includes two calibration diluents (Calibrator Diluent I for serum/plasma testing and Calibrator Diluent II for cell culture supernatant testing.) According to the testing system, the provided standard is diluted (2-fold) with the appropriate Calibrator Diluent and assayed at the same time as the samples. This allows the operator to produce a standard curve of Optical Density (O.D) versus IL-13 Rα2 concentration. The concentration of IL-13 Rα2 in the samples is then determined by comparing the O.D. of the samples to the standard curve.
